gpt4 book ai didi

java - Apache POI 中工作表的默认样式

转载 作者:行者123 更新时间:2023-11-30 07:08:26 25 4
gpt4 key购买 nike

我正在尝试弄清楚如何使用 POI 和 XSSF 文件为工作表指定默认 CellStyle。

据我所知,如果我在工作簿上调用 getCellStyle(0),我将恢复工作簿的默认样式,并且可以根据需要进行修改。我还可以在工作表上调用 setDefaultColumnStyle(index, style) ,这将允许我为特定列中创建的新单元格设置默认样式。但是,如果没有遍历所有列并在每个列上调用此方法(这将非常浪费),我看不到有任何方法可以为特定工作表的所有单元格设置默认样式。 (如果提前知道用户可能选择填充哪些列,则逐列设置是可以的,但如果用户可以编辑工作簿中的任何单元格,则并不理想,并且仍应应用默认值。)

我错过了什么吗?有没有办法为特定工作表设置默认的单元格样式?谢谢。

最佳答案

  • 使用预定义的 Excel 模板和工作表的默认单元格样式。
  • 在 Java 代码中自定义工作表(其他格式、用户特定的业务逻辑)。

关于java - Apache POI 中工作表的默认样式,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/39646382/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com